Ines Kusmenko, MSc

Ines Kusmenko has been working as an economist in the Research Group "Regional Economics and Spatial Analysis" at WIFO since January 2025. Her research focuses on the effects of demographic change as well as inequality and wealth research. Ines Kusmenko holds a Master's degree in Economics from the Vienna University of Economics and Business (WU Vienna) and a Bachelor's degree in International Business Studies from Friedrich-Alexander University Erlangen-Nuremberg (FAU) with study visits to Corvinus University of Budapest and the University of Latvia. Before joining WIFO, Ines Kusmenko worked at the Oesterreichische Nationalbank (OeNB), the Heinrich-Böll-Stiftung in Sarajevo and the European Bank for Reconstruction and Development (EBRD) in London.
